Biker Boyz

Description
The life of a young courageous guy whose father is a well known man owns a motorcycle club, where all its members are African Americans, who achieves a great success, struggles against regaining fame and the popularity of their club, after the illness of his father, the thing that makes him does his best in fighting his enemies.
